MANILA, Philippines — Several schools have suspended classes in observance of the 39th anniversary of the Epifanio Delos Santos Avenue (Edsa) People Power Revolution on Tuesday, February 25.

This is despite Malacañang’s  declaration that the Edsa People Power anniversary is a special working holiday.

“Kasama ako sa inyong paninindigan at pagpapahalaga sa pag-gunita ng makasaysayang pangyayaring na dapat pinapahalagahan at hindi kinakalimutan,” former senator Bam Aquino said in a statement.

(I am one with your conviction and valuing the commemoration of a historic event that should be remembered and never forgotten.)

“Patuloy tayong kumilos upang manatiling buhay ang alaala ng Edsa People Power, kung saan sama-samang tumindig at lumaban ang sambayanang Pilipino para sa kalayaang tinatamasa natin ngayon,” Aquino added.

(We will continue to keep the memory of the EDSA People Power alive, during which Filipinos stood up and fought as one for the freedom we enjoy now.)  With reports from Keith Irish Margareth Clores, trainee
